Metal Cardbot at BotCon '25 - What's new?

4 PM PST: Updated to clarify TCG information. (It's not being planned at the moment.)

Thank you to @rinovarka for covering this event! Please see the full Twitter thread for more info.

What's new since Toyfair in February?

  • Names have been changed, again. See below.
  • They showcased the first episode of the dub at the panel. The dub appears to be the same as the existing one, even down to the old names (Blue Cop, Mega Trucker). Rino writes that "A light apology is given for the English dubbing, as it was done for affordability, and that Season 2's localization should be better."
  • If the first wave is received well, then there's more justification for quality dubbing, marketing, etc.. Lots of things (human figures, comic, etc) were answered with "if it does well, then maybe!",
  • There are talks about making a new Metal Cardbot TCG for the US audience, since TCGs don't attract much attention in Asia, but it's hypothetical (source)
  • They hope that MCB becomes good competition in the transforming robot market (people who work on MCB know TF and the American market, and study them for fresh views/ideas).
  • Planned to be distributed at Entertainment Earth, BBTS, and Amazon in Fall 2025. They hope to distribute to larger, in-person retailers in the future... "maybe"
  • Prototype packaging was shown off (see below) - not final

Prototype Packaging (Toyfair vs BotCon)

Toyfair coverage: misswhynowhy on Twitter

Cardbots

Season 1, Wave 1 (releasing Late 2025/2026)

Names are not final, and "they acknowledge the translated names arent that great right now", and that they're still tweaking them (and possibly the names in the dub).

Names marked in blue are new.

  • Blue Star (Blue Cop, formerly Blue Cobalt) - $23.99
  • Shadow X - $23.99
  • Bluster Gale (Buster Gallon) - $23.99
  • Mech Tackle (Mega Trucker) - $32.99
  • Steel Hook (Black Hook) - $32.99
  • Heavy Iron - $49.99

Season 1, TBD price and release date

  • Wild Guardian (Wild Guardy)
  • Buffalo Crush
  • Med Alert (Mega Ambler)
  • Fire Buster (Phoenix Fire)
  • Dextrous (Dexter)
  • Fleta Z
  • Ultimate Blue Star (Ultimate Blue Cop)

While Season 2 toys were shown off at the event, there was no timeline or plans announced to bring them to US retailers.

TL;DR: Dub is the same. More names changed, though none of it is final. The first wave'll come out in late 2025, along with the dub on Tubi and YouTube, which'll probably be very similar to the one we already have. "Loud support when MCB hits the Western Market greatly needed to justify bigger and better things :]" - Rino

Where Are Astral Chain's Major Speedrun Skips?

UPDATE: A new skip has been discovered that skips from File 02 to File 11! Though it's not without caveats: you already need a save file at File 11 in the first place. It's being run at SGDQ 2024, but a great explanation of the glitch can be found here.

A lot of video games have "ultra shortcuts", ways to skip hours of an otherwise completely linear game. Many of these take the form of clipping into loading areas left behind by the developer, or warping to the credits using some obscure trick.

Astral Chain has been out for over three years now, and has a relatively active speedrunning community (hell, ratyu's going to be speedrunning it at GDQ this year!). So, clearly there should be at least some major game-breaking glitch that lets you skip significant parts of a file, right?

Well... there isn't. The biggest skips speedrunners have found are in the Astral Plane sections, with some notable skips being the File 03 Hal skip, File 05 Beast fight, and second Hal Skip. But even those save a handful of minutes at best in a two and a half hour speedrun.

So, what gives?
